MySQL是一个开源的关系型数据库管理系统,用于存储和管理大量结构化数据。在MySQL中,索引是一种数据结构,用于提高查询效率和数据的唯一性。索引可以加速数据的查找和匹配过程,从而提高查询的性能。
在MySQL中,可以使用索引来防止重复数据库的方法是通过创建唯一索引。唯一索引是一种索引类型,它要求索引列的值在表中是唯一的,即不允许重复值出现。当尝试向唯一索引列插入重复值时,MySQL会报错并阻止插入操作。
要创建一个唯一索引,可以使用以下语法:
CREATE UNIQUE INDEX index_name ON table_name (column_name);
其中,index_name
是索引的名称,table_name
是要创建索引的表名,column_name
是要创建索引的列名。
创建唯一索引后,可以避免在该列上出现重复值,从而确保数据的完整性和唯一性。
在腾讯云的MySQL产品中,可以使用云数据库MySQL来进行数据库管理和配置。云数据库MySQL提供了稳定可靠的数据库服务,具有高可用性、灵活扩展和安全可靠的特点。您可以在腾讯云官网上了解更多关于云数据库MySQL的信息,包括产品介绍、优势、应用场景等。以下是相关链接地址:
腾讯云数据库MySQL产品介绍:https://cloud.tencent.com/product/cdb_mysql
通过使用腾讯云数据库MySQL,您可以方便地设置唯一索引来防止重复数据库,并享受腾讯云提供的稳定高效的数据库服务。
领取专属 10元无门槛券
手把手带您无忧上云